Subscription and Notification
The concept of subscription consists of automatically notifying one or more users that an event has occurred on a selected document or folder.
Whenever events take place, users will receive a new notification and a message via email (if this option is enabled in the user’s preferences) to inform them.
Triggering notifications
The actions that trigger notifications on folders and documents are as follows:
- Adding a folder or document
- Editing a folder or document
- Deleting a folder or document
- Adding a new version of a document
- Modifying an existing version
- Deleting a version of a document
- Uploading a document
- Copying a document

Manage subscriptions from the file browsing or search result interface
View subscriptions
An icon is used to identify the subscribed files during the journey through the tree.

Subscribing to a file
You will be informed, by notification in the dashboard and by email (if this option is enabled in the user’s preferences), of any changes made in the future to the documents in this folder.

Subscriptions on folders are recursive. When you subscribe to a folder, you also subscribe to all of its subfolders.
Delete a subscription
To deactivate a subscription to a folder, select the folder and then select “Delete Subscription” from the drop-down menu.

Add or remove bulk subscriptions
It is also possible to add or remove subscriptions in bulk.
Manage subscriptions from preferences
View all of your subscriptions
A page where you can view all your subscriptions. Click on your profile picture, click on Preferences , and select “Manage My Subscriptions” from the drop-down menu.

This page appears:

You can also filter the view to show only subscriptions from a selected folder and subfolders, using the “Filter Parent Subfolder” button.
Delete a subscription
Select the folder, in the action menu select “Delete subscription“.

Subscriptions on folders are recursive. When you delete a subscription to a folder, you also delete the subscription to all of its subfolders.
You have the option to delete multiple subscriptions at the same time. To do this, select several folders, then in the “Actions” column click on “Actions on the selection” and select “Remove subscription to selected folders“
Subscribing to a file
Simply click on the “Add a subscription” button and select the folder to subscribe from the tree view.

Subscriptions on folders are recursive. When you subscribe to a folder, you also subscribe to all of its subfolders.
